var currentsize = 2;

function fontresize(resizer, defsize) {
    if (!document.getElementById) return;
    if (resizer == 0) {
	  currentsize = defsize;
    } else if (resizer == 1) {
      if (currentsize < 6) currentsize += 1;
    } else if (resizer == -1) {
      if (currentsize>0) currentsize -= 1;
    }
    var taglist = new Array( 'div','table','tr','td','p','a','span', 'h2');
    //var taglist = new Array( 'p');
    var i;
    var j;
    var docTags;
    var sizeArray = new Array('xx-small','x-small','small','medium','large','x-large','xx-large');

    for (i=0; i<taglist.length; i++) {
        docTags = document.getElementById('conteudo').getElementsByTagName(taglist[i]);
        for (j=0; j<docTags.length; j++) {
            docTags[j].style.fontSize =  sizeArray[currentsize];
        }
    }	
}
